The Foldable Revolution: Why Form Factor Matters More Than Ever

The smartphone industry has reached a saturation point in many developed markets. Annual upgrades have become increasingly incremental, with consumers questioning the value of paying premium prices for marginal improvements. This has led to a strategic pivot among manufacturers toward experience innovation—creating devices that fundamentally change how users engage with technology, rather than just enhancing existing capabilities.

Foldable phones represent the most significant leap in form factor since the launch of the first iPhone in 2007. They challenge the one-size-fits-all design of traditional smartphones by offering two distinct modes of operation: a compact, pocket-friendly device for on-the-go use, and a larger, tablet-like display for immersive experiences such as video consumption, multitasking, and content creation.

According to a 2025 report by Counterpoint Research, global shipments of foldable smartphones are projected to exceed 60 million units annually by 2027, up from approximately 25 million in 2024. This explosive growth is not merely a result of novelty; it reflects a deeper shift in consumer behavior. Users are increasingly demanding devices that can seamlessly transition between productivity and entertainment, especially in contexts where space and time are limited.

Design That Defies Convention: The Razr Fold’s Human-Centric Philosophy

One of the most persistent criticisms of foldable phones has been their perceived bulkiness and ergonomic inefficiency. Early models from various brands were often criticized for awkward hinges, fragile displays, and uncomfortable grips. Motorola’s approach with the Razr Fold has been to confront these challenges head-on through a design philosophy rooted in human-centric engineering.

The Razr Fold features a large 8.1-inch inner foldable display paired with a 6.56-inch external cover screen. At first glance, this might suggest a device that is unwieldy or top-heavy. Yet, at just 243 grams, the Razr Fold is surprisingly lightweight—comparable to many flagship smartphones like the iPhone 15 Pro or the Samsung Galaxy S24 Ultra. This weight reduction is achieved through the use of advanced aerospace-grade aluminum in the frame and a more efficient battery configuration.

The device’s hinge mechanism, while slightly heavier than Samsung’s ultra-thin variants, has been engineered for durability. Independent durability tests conducted by TechInsights in 2025 revealed that the Razr Fold’s hinge maintained structural integrity after over 200,000 fold cycles—equivalent to roughly five years of daily use. This is critical for users in regions like Northeast India, where devices are often subjected to rough handling due to uneven infrastructure and limited access to repair services.

Ergonomically, the Razr Fold introduces a concave grip design on the rear panel, which naturally cradles the device in the palm. This feature, combined with a textured matte finish, significantly reduces the risk of accidental drops—a common issue in humid or rainy climates. The rear panel also incorporates a refined metal frame that dissipates heat efficiently, addressing a persistent concern in foldable devices where heat buildup can degrade performance.

Motorola’s design choices reflect a deep understanding of the diverse user base in emerging markets. Unlike premium brands that often prioritize aesthetics over practicality, the Razr Fold balances elegance with utility. Its compact closed form factor makes it easy to carry in a pocket or small bag, while the expansive inner display transforms it into a mini-tablet for reading, note-taking, or video conferencing.

Software and Ecosystem: Can Motorola Compete Beyond Hardware?

While hardware innovation is critical, the true value of a foldable phone lies in its software ecosystem. A large foldable display is only as useful as the apps and operating system that can leverage it effectively. Motorola has taken a pragmatic approach by leveraging Android 15 with Motorola’s near-stock UI, which minimizes bloatware and ensures smooth performance.

One of the standout features of the Razr Fold is its Adaptive Display Mode, which automatically adjusts the aspect ratio and scaling of apps when the device is unfolded. This ensures that apps designed for standard smartphones don’t appear stretched or pixelated on the larger screen. Early adopters in Bengaluru and Pune have praised this feature for enabling seamless multitasking—whether splitting the screen between a video call and a document, or using floating windows for side-by-side app usage.

However, the foldable ecosystem is still in its infancy. As of early 2026, only 12% of Android apps are fully optimized for foldable devices, according to App Annie. This includes apps like Google Docs, Microsoft Office, and YouTube, which offer split-screen and expanded display support. But many third-party apps, particularly in gaming and social media, remain unoptimized.

Motorola has attempted to address this gap through partnerships with Indian developers. In collaboration with the Ministry of Electronics and Information Technology (MeitY), the company launched the Foldable India Initiative in 2025, offering grants to local developers to optimize apps for foldable screens. This initiative aims to create a more inclusive digital environment, particularly for regional languages like Assamese, Bodo, and Mizo.

The success of this ecosystem-building effort will be crucial for the Razr Fold’s long-term viability in India. While hardware specifications are impressive, the device’s true potential lies in its ability to integrate into users’ daily workflows—whether for professional tasks, educational pursuits, or entertainment.

Challenges and Criticisms: The Road Ahead for Foldables

Despite its many advantages, the foldable smartphone market is not without its challenges. Durability remains a top concern. While Motorola’s hinge and display have passed rigorous tests, the broader industry has seen instances of screen creasing, hinge wear, and water damage in foldable devices. Samsung, for instance, had to issue software updates to address issues with its Ultra Thin Glass (UTG) displays after reports of micro-cracks surfaced in 2024.

Another challenge is the lack of standardized repair infrastructure. In Northeast India, where access to authorized service centers is limited, users may face difficulties in getting their devices repaired. Motorola has attempted to mitigate this by training local technicians and expanding its service network, but the ecosystem is still evolving.

There is also the question of whether consumers truly need a foldable phone. Skeptics argue that traditional smartphones with high-resolution displays and advanced cameras can meet most users’ needs. However, the growing popularity of tablets and 2-in-1 laptops suggests that there is a demand for larger screens in portable form factors. Foldables bridge this gap, offering a middle ground between the convenience of a smartphone and the productivity of a tablet.
